My Review
Ahh, I enjoyed this book. I have said it before, and I will say it again but listening to the audiobook is the way to experience this series. Love listening to Samantha and Gabriel voice the audiobook. Another nice addition to this series.
If you like slow burn romances and single dad trope, you will want to read this book or listen to it. I am a sucker for a hot, single dad. Noah is such a great dad. He is so caring.
Victoria is sweet. She and Noah may have had a slight bumpy start with each other but the more time they spent with each other, you could see them coming around. It made the connection between them that more genuine.
